For those short on time fly-in cruises are an efficient option. Flying into Antarctica and joining your vessel right away means you start your cruise on the same day you leave the mainland. Fly-in cruises will depart from Chile and take you straight to King George Island.

When to visit

During Antarctica’s summer – November to March, with December to January being the optimal time. From mid to late December the penguin chicks start to hatch, and in January you will catch the feeding frenzy that ensues. February to early March is the best time to spot whales, and there are generally a good number of fur seals to be seen too.
